[Effects of Electroacupuncture and Moxibustion Pretreatment on Expressions of HSP 27, HSP 70, HSP 90 at Different Time-points in Rabbits with Myocardial Ischemia-reperfusion Injury].

Abstract

OBJECTIVE

To observe the effect of electroacupuncture (EA) and moxibustion (Moxi) pretreatment on expression of myocardial heat shock protein (HSP) in acute myocardial ischemia-reperfusion injury (MIRI) rabbits.

METHODS

A total of 72 New Zealand rabbits were randomly divided into 4 groups:sham operation, MIRI model, EA pretreatment and Moxi pretreatment (=18 rabbits in each group) which were further divided into 0, 24 and 48 h (time-point) subgroups (=6 in each). The MIRI model was established by occlusion of the anterior descending branch (ADB) of the left coronary artery for 40 min and reperfusion for 60 min. EA and Moxi stimulation was respectively applied to bilateral "Neiguan"(PC 6) for 20 min, once daily for 5 days before ADB occlusion. The expressions of myocardial HSP 27, HSP 70 and HSP 90 were detected by immunohistochemistry. The pathological and ultrastructural changes of left ventricular ischemia tissue were observed under light and transmission electronic microscope (TEM), respectively.

RESULTS

Outcomes of H.E. staining and ultrastructure showed that MIRI-induced changes of disordered arrangement of cardiomyocytes, vague myocardial transverse striation, inflammatory infiltration, cardiac myofibre necrosis and fibrolysis (light microscope), and myofiber atrophy, vague and disorder in the arrangement of myofiber, myofilament necrosis, interstitial edema, mitochondrial swelling, microvessel expansion, etc. (TEM) were relatively milder in both EA and Moxi pretreatment groups (48 h). In comparison with the sham group, the expression levels of myocardial HSP 27, HSP 70 and HSP 90 had no significant changes after MIRI at the 3 time-points (>0.05). In the pretreatment groups, the expression levels of HSP 27 at 24 and 48 h in both EA and Moxi groups, HSP 70 at 48 h in both groups, HSP 70 at 0 and 24 h in the Moxi group were significantly up-regulated compared with the model group (<0.05, <0.01). No significant changes were found in the expression of HSP 90 at the 3 time-points in the EA and Moxi pretreatment groups (>0.05). No significant differences were found between EA and Moxi in up-regulating expressions of myocardial HSP 27, HSP 70 and HSP 90 proteins at the 3 time-points (>0.05) except HSP 70 at 24 h (Moxi being stronger relative to EA, <0.05).

CONCLUSIONS

EA and Moxi pretreatment has a protective effect on ischemic myocardium in MIRI rabbits, which Feb be associated with their actions in up-regulating myocardial HSP 27 and HSP 70 expression.

摘要

目的

观察电针(EA)和艾灸(Moxi)预处理对急性心肌缺血再灌注损伤(MIRI)家兔心肌热休克蛋白(HSP)表达的影响。

方法

将72只新西兰家兔随机分为4组:假手术组、MIRI模型组、EA预处理组和Moxi预处理组(每组18只),每组再分为0、24和48 h(时间点)亚组(每组6只)。通过结扎左冠状动脉前降支(ADB)40 min后再灌注60 min建立MIRI模型。在结扎ADB前,分别对双侧“内关”(PC 6)进行EA和Moxi刺激20 min,每日1次,共5天。采用免疫组织化学法检测心肌HSP 27、HSP 70和HSP 90的表达。分别在光镜和透射电子显微镜(TEM)下观察左心室缺血组织的病理和超微结构变化。

结果

苏木精-伊红(H.E.)染色和超微结构结果显示,EA和Moxi预处理组(48 h)MIRI诱导的心肌细胞排列紊乱、心肌横纹模糊、炎症浸润、心肌纤维坏死和溶解(光镜),以及肌纤维萎缩、肌纤维排列模糊和紊乱、肌丝坏死、间质水肿、线粒体肿胀、微血管扩张等(TEM)变化相对较轻。与假手术组相比,MIRI后3个时间点心肌HSP 27、HSP 70和HSP 90的表达水平无显著变化(>0.05)。在预处理组中,与模型组相比,EA组和Moxi组24和48 h的HSP 27表达水平、两组48 h的HSP 70表达水平、Moxi组0和24 h的HSP 70表达水平均显著上调(<0.05,<0.01)。EA和Moxi预处理组3个时间点的HSP 90表达无显著变化(>0.05)。除24 h的HSP 70(Moxi相对于EA更强,<0.05)外,EA和Moxi在3个时间点上调心肌HSP 27、HSP 70和HSP 90蛋白表达方面无显著差异(>0.05)。

结论

EA和Moxi预处理对MIRI家兔缺血心肌具有保护作用,这可能与其上调心肌HSP 27和HSP 70表达有关。
